Product
arrow
Pricing
arrow
Resource
arrow
Use Cases
arrow
Locations
arrow
Help Center
arrow
Program
arrow
WhatsApp
WhatsApp
WhatsApp
Email
Email
Enterprise Service
Enterprise Service
menu
WhatsApp
WhatsApp
Email
Email
Enterprise Service
Enterprise Service
Submit
pyproxy Basic information
pyproxy Waiting for a reply
Your form has been submitted. We'll contact you in 24 hours.
Close
Home/ Blog/ How to design load balancing and failover strategies for buy datacenter proxies?

How to design load balancing and failover strategies for buy datacenter proxies?

PYPROXY PYPROXY · Sep 15, 2025

When purchasing datacenter proxies, it is crucial to design robust load balancing and failover strategies to ensure reliability, security, and optimal performance. A well-structured load balancing strategy ensures that traffic is distributed evenly across multiple servers, preventing any single server from being overwhelmed. Meanwhile, failover mechanisms provide redundancy, ensuring that if one server fails, another can seamlessly take over, minimizing downtime. In this article, we will explore how to design effective load balancing and failover strategies when buying datacenter proxies, with a focus on ensuring smooth performance and high availability.

Understanding the Importance of Load Balancing and Failover in Datacenter Proxies

Before delving into the specifics of designing these strategies, it's essential to grasp why load balancing and failover are crucial in the context of datacenter proxies. Datacenter proxies are often used in high-demand environments, such as web scraping, online data aggregation, or managing multiple user sessions. These tasks require seamless access to the internet through proxies that are reliable, fast, and scalable. Without proper load balancing, some proxies may become overburdened, leading to slow response times or even failure. Similarly, without failover mechanisms, service interruptions can occur if one server or proxy goes offline.

Load balancing and failover strategies ensure that your proxy network can handle large volumes of requests efficiently while maintaining high availability. These strategies protect against system downtime and ensure that users experience minimal disruptions.

Key Factors to Consider When Designing Load Balancing Strategies for Datacenter Proxies

1. Traffic Distribution Methods

The first step in designing an effective load balancing strategy is selecting the appropriate method for distributing traffic. There are several types of traffic distribution mechanisms to choose from, each with its strengths and weaknesses.

- Round Robin: This method distributes traffic evenly across available proxies without considering their current load. While simple, it might not be the most effective if some proxies are faster or have more resources than others.

- Least Connections: This method directs traffic to the proxy with the least number of active connections. It helps balance load by considering the current server load, making it more efficient than round-robin in many cases.

- Weighted Round Robin: This method assigns a "weight" to each proxy based on its capacity and current load. Proxies with higher resources or performance capabilities handle more traffic, which leads to a more balanced system.

- IP Hash: This method uses the client’s IP address to determine which proxy server will handle the request. It ensures that the same client always uses the same proxy, which can be important for maintaining session persistence.

Choosing the right method depends on your specific use case and the nature of your proxy network.

2. Server Health Monitoring

To maintain effective load balancing, you must continuously monitor the health of your proxy servers. Server health checks ensure that requests are not routed to unhealthy or unavailable proxies. These checks can be configured to assess various parameters such as response times, resource usage, or the number of active connections.

A server health monitoring system can automatically detect when a proxy server is underperforming or has failed and reroute traffic to another server in real-time, ensuring minimal disruption to the service.

3. Scalability and Auto-scaling

A key challenge when designing load balancing strategies is ensuring scalability. As traffic grows, additional proxies may need to be added to the network. Auto-scaling ensures that your load balancing system can automatically add or remove proxies based on demand.

By integrating cloud services or scalable infrastructure, you can enable dynamic adjustments to the number of proxies available, allowing the system to handle fluctuations in traffic without manual intervention.

4. Geographical Considerations

For global businesses or applications with users from different geographical locations, geographical load balancing becomes essential. Traffic should be routed to the nearest available proxy server to minimize latency and improve performance. This requires a load balancing strategy that can intelligently route traffic based on the client’s location and the server's proximity.

Designing Failover Strategies for Datacenter Proxies

1. Redundant Systems

To ensure high availability, it's essential to design a redundant system for your proxy servers. A simple failover strategy might involve setting up backup proxy servers that automatically take over if a primary server fails. These backup proxies should be synchronized with the primary servers to ensure that they can pick up where the primary server left off, minimizing downtime.

A more advanced failover system involves using multiple data centers. If one data center goes offline, traffic can be routed to another data center to maintain service availability. This type of geographical redundancy provides an additional layer of protection against large-scale failures.

2. Active-Passive vs. Active-Active Failover Models

There are two primary types of failover models:

- Active-Passive Failover: In this model, one server is actively handling traffic, while the other server remains on standby, ready to take over in case of failure. This model is simple but might result in unused resources on the standby server.

- Active-Active Failover: In this model, all servers are actively handling traffic, and if one server fails, the remaining servers automatically take over the load. This model ensures better resource utilization but may require more complex configurations.

Selecting the right failover model depends on the level of redundancy required and the resources available.

3. Automated Failover Systems

An automated failover system ensures that when a proxy server fails, traffic is immediately rerouted without any manual intervention. These systems continuously monitor server health and perform failover actions based on predefined criteria.

Automatic failover minimizes downtime and reduces the risk of service interruptions. Integration with load balancing systems ensures that the overall traffic is efficiently redistributed, maintaining the performance and availability of the proxy network.

4. Testing Failover and Redundancy Plans

Failover and redundancy plans should be thoroughly tested to ensure they work as expected. Regular testing should simulate server failures and evaluate the system's response. This allows businesses to identify potential weak points in their failover strategy before an actual failure occurs.

Testing also ensures that failover mechanisms are seamless and that the load balancing system continues to function optimally after a failover event.

Conclusion: Ensuring Reliable Datacenter Proxy Performance

Designing effective load balancing and failover strategies is crucial for ensuring the reliability, performance, and availability of datacenter proxies. By considering factors such as traffic distribution, server health monitoring, scalability, and redundancy, businesses can build a robust infrastructure that can handle high traffic volumes while minimizing downtime. Additionally, integrating automated systems and conducting regular failover tests ensures that the proxy network remains resilient in the face of potential failures. With the right strategies in place, organizations can optimize their proxy performance and provide a seamless experience for users.

Related Posts

Clicky